7
terhadap data yang disimpan dalam basis data (Coronel dan Rob, 2011,
p7).
DBMS memungkinkan data yang berada di dalam basis data dapat dibagi dan
dipakai secara bersama oleh pengguna.
DBMS memungkinkan pengguna
untuk mendefinisikan, membuat, memelihara, dan mengontrol akses terhadap
basis data (Connolly dan Begg, 2005, p16).
DBMS menyediakan
beberapa bahasa yang dapat digunakan oleh
pengguna
untuk berinteraksi
dengan basis data dan aplikasi
(Connolly dan
Begg, 2005, p16), yaitu:
1.
Data Definition Language (DDL)
Memungkinkan pengguna untuk mendefinisikan basis data. Pengguna
dapat menentukan spesifikasi jenis data, struktur data, dan batasan data
yang ingin disimpan ke dalam basis data.
2.
Data Manipulation Language (DML)
Memungkinkan pengguna untuk memasukkan, memperbaharui,
menghapus dan mengambil data dari basis data.
Menurut Connolly dan Begg (2005,
p18),
terdapat lima
komponen
penting dalam DBMS, yaitu :
1.
Perangkat Keras
DBMS dan aplikasi membutuhkan perangkat keras agar dapat
dijalankan. Perangkat keras bisa berupa komputer pribadi, mainframe,
hingga jaringan komputer.
Perangkat keras yang digunakan
tergantung dari kebutuhan organisasi dan DBMS yang digunakan.
2.
Perangkat Lunak
|